Step 1: Research Trending Topics

  • Identify Trends: Use plat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ube itself to find trending topics and popular formats.
  • Analyze Competitors: Look at successful Shorts in your niche to see what works for them.
  • Keyword Research: Utilize tools like VidIQ to discover keywords that are currently gaining traction.

Step 2: Create a Compelling Script

  • Hook Your Audience: Start with an engaging hook in the first few seconds to capture attention.
  • Keep It Concise: Aim for a script that is 30-60 seconds long, focusing on delivering your message quickly.
  • Include a Call to Action: Encourage viewers to like, comment, or share at the end of your Short.

Step 3: Plan Your Visuals

  • Storyboarding: Outline your video visually to ensure a smooth flow. Use Notion for planning your shots and scenes.
  • Choose Your Shots: Decide on the types of shots you’ll need (e.g., close-ups, wide shots) to keep the visual interest high.
  • Consider Lighting and Background: Ensure good lighting and a clean background to enhance video quality.

Step 4: Film Your Short

  • Use Quality Equipment: While smartphones are great, ensure that you have good audio quality. Consider using an external microphone.
  • Experiment with Angles: Vary your camera angles to keep the video dynamic.
  • Limit Distractions: Film in a quiet space to avoid background noise.

Step 5: Edit Your Video

  • Editing Software: Use tools like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ro, or free options like DaVinci Resolve.
  • Trim Unnecessary Footage: Cut out any dead space or mistakes to keep the pace fast.
  • Add Text and Effects: Use on-screen text for emphasis and effects to enhance engagement, but don’t overdo it.

Step 6: Select the Right Music

  • Choose Copyright-Free Music: Use platforms like YouTube Audio Library or Epidemic Sound for music that can enhance your video without copyright issues.
  • Match the Mood: Select music that complements the tone of your Short. For example, action-packed music for energetic content.

Step 7: Optimize for YouTube

  • Craft a Catchy Title: Make sure your title is engaging and contains keywords for better discoverability.
  • Create an Eye-Catching Thumbnail: Even for Shorts, a good thumbnail can attract viewers.
  • Tag and Description: Use relevant tags and a clear description to help YouTube categorize your content.

Step 8: Promote Your Short

  • Share on Social Media: Promote your Short on platforms like Instagram, Twitter, and TikTok to reach a wider audience.
  • Engage with Your Audience: Respond to comments and interact with viewers to build a community.
  • Collaborate with Other Creators: Partnering with others can help you tap into their audience.
